Spaghetti pulao
About:
Do you like noodles or Spaghetti…Wondered how it tastes with indian spices.. Try this variation called ‘Spaghetti Pulao’… Goodness of all veggies and flavour of indian spices all in one dish.
The dish looks like HAKKA noodles with all veggies. The Indian spices makes you feel you are having Pulao…
Enjoy this unique taste Pulao.
Yields: 3-4 servings
Preparation time: 15 minutes
Cooking time: 20 minutes
Ingredients:
- Whole wheat spaghetti-250 gms
- Sliced carrots-1 medium
- Sliced French beans-1/4 cup
- Sliced bell peppers/capsicum-1 medium
- Sliced onion-1 medium
- Cauliflower florets – 10-12 (washed and cleaned)
- Chopped tomatoes-2 medium
- Frozen peas-1/4 cup
- Minced ginger-1/2 inch
- Minced garlic-3 cloves
- Minced green chillies- 3
- Cloves-4
- Cinnamon-1 inch stick
- Bay leaf-1
- Green cardamom-2
- Star Anise/Chinese Star Anise- 2 petals
- Fennel seeds/saunf- 1 tsp
- Salt and ground pepper- to taste
- Olive oil-1 tablespoon
Garnish:
- Roasted nuts/ fried onions
Procedure:
- Bring large pot of water to boil, add in spaghetti, salt and cook as directed on package. Once cooked drain and set aside.
- Heat oil in the pan add in clove, cinnamon, fennel seeds, cardamom, anise petals, bay leaf and saute for 10-20 seconds.
- Then add in onion, minced ginger, garlic, green chillies and saute for 2-3 minutes.
- Add carrots, bell peppers, beans, Cauliflower florets and saute until heated but not completely cooked.
- Add tomatoes and peas season with salt, ground pepper saute for 2 more minutes.
- Add cooked and drained spaghetti and toss with vegetables until combined, simmer for 2-3 minutes more or until heated through.
- Turn off the flame -garnish with nuts
- Serve hot
Try serving this with Manchurian
Note:
- Whole spices can be discarded while biting or alternatively ground them to fine powder and use.
- Spices and Veggies can be personalised as per the taste.
- Spaghetti can be replaced with noodles/pasta and follow the same procedure.
